I have a couple of odd scenarios with Dark Eldar list building in the new Dex and the Book of Rust, I'd like to check if I'm parsing through things correctly or if I have missed something. Most of this is not a good/competitive idea, I'm just curious about the rules. I'll present an army list and then ask a number of questions to find out what the correct interpretations are. Thank you for your answers in advance.

Army List

Real Space Raid Battalion
Obsessions: Cult of Strife, Black Heart, Dark Creed

HQ
Archon (Warlord) [Black Heart]
Succubus [Cult of Strife]
Haemonculus [Dark Creed]

Troops
5 Wyches [Cult of Strife]
5 Wracks [Dark Creed]
5 Kabalite Warriors [Black Heart]

Patrol
Obsession: Cult of Strife
HQ
Drazhar

Troops
5 Kabalite Warriors [Poisoned Tongue]

Questions

1) Cult of Strife/Book of Rust Rules
....i) Is it legal for the patrol to be declared Cult of Strife even though there are no Cult of Strife units in it?
....ii) If the answer to (i) is "Yes" then does this unlock the stratagems and warlord traits from the Book of Rust?
....iii) If the answers to (i) and (ii) are yes would this allow me to take a Dark Lotus Toxin on the succubus in the Realspace Raid?
....iv) If the answers to (i) and (ii) are yes would this allow me to take Competetive Edge using Alliance of Agony?

2) Codex Rules
....i) Would it be possible to use the Poisoned Tongues Insidious Misdirection stratagem on the Kabalite Warriors in the Cult of Strife detachment, even though there is no Poisoned Tongue detachment?
....ii) Is it permissible to keep the Overlord Aura on the Archon instead of switching it, to allow him to give rerolls to Drazhar?

I think the answer to all of the above questions is yes, but some of them feel like they should be no, so I am assuming I might be missing something.

i) Per the rules in Codex Supplement: Cult of Strife a Cult of Strife detachment is one containing only Cult of Strife, along with Blades for Hire and Unaligned units. The detachment in your list is not a Cult of Strife detachment as it contains no Cult of Strife units and does contain a Poisoned Tongue unit.
ii) The detachment in your list is not a Cult of Strife detachment and therefore does not unlock Cult of Strife stratagems.
iii) You cannot take Dark Lotus Toxin because your army does not have a Cult of Strife warlord.
iv) You may take the Competitive Edge warlord trait because that only requires your character gaining a warlord trait be a Cult of Strife character.

i) No. Per the rules on sub-faction Stratagems you must have either Kabal detachment or a Realspace Raid detachment with Poison Tongue as the Kabal to gain access to the Kabal stratagem.
ii) It is permissible as you can as opposed to being required to replace the Overlord ability.
